I made this experimental art project/game that's an LLM chat assistant, but where you're the AI. I wanted people to get a visceral sense of what it's like to answer the kinds of things that people prompt their chatbots day in and day out. If you're interested, I wrote up some more info on how I made it, including how the "user" prompts are generated with an eye for realism: https://bethechatbot.com/about Hope you enjoy it! I'd love to hear people's takeaways.

Hey all - We wanted to see if chatbots could self-develop unique personalities through social media interactions. The results were actually hilarious... but wanted to share a bit about our process and see if anyone had any comments or insights. So first we initialize the bots with a basic personality that's similar to if you were selecting attributes for an MMO. Things like intelligence, toxicity, charisma and the like. There are also a couple of other fields like intrinsic desire and a brief character description. These are fed to the model as a system prompt with each inference. For the…
